I'll add Cullen Wilson (Belfry) at UK 1956-1959, Greg Battistello (Belfry) at North Carolina 1962-1966, James Ramey (Belfry) at Kentucky 1975-1979, Lee Dotson (Belfry) at Kentucky 1982-1985.
Also Austin Dotson from Belfry is currently at UK, just finished his freshman season.

Since the change to 6 classes in 2007, Central has only lost 2 playoff games at home. To Wayne Co in 2013 and to Lexington Catholic in 2015.
